    • @rmg480
      @rmg480 2 місяці тому +161

      It's an easy mistake to make possibly because they wanted for us to be able to see the frames, but impact frames are something you process almost unconsciously. You don't see each individual frame in all of their complete detail, but it creates a specific visual effect that the animator is looking for.

    @Telmach 2 місяці тому +59

    15:04 That one single person made this is damned impressive. The smear frames really worked with Zod - but with guts in the first shot his arms look thin and noodly. It might read better if his arms were widened at the shoulders and tapered down towards the thickness you went for in the final shot by his wrists.
    After Guts was sent flying could benefit from some minor tweaks as well. As he's flying through the air, slightly stretching and tapering him would convey higher speed. Faint action lines in the shape of a cone around him mimicking a supersonic mock cone is also effective at doing that. There is no visible plowed snow from where Guts impacts and drags along his back. If when he impacted the ground it kicked up some dirt & grass, had a more substantial thud sound, and had some screen shake it would really sell the power from Zod's tackle.
    All minor things mind you. You did a knock out job!

    @emanuel3617 2 місяці тому +3

    This looks amazing!!! The impact scene with the swords is perfect!!! Oh only one think that could make the animation even better is the litghting. When trying to create anime look in 3D I found out that most of the time you don't want the lights to be realistic, you will often want to place fake spots of lights in dark areas and maybe more suns that don't make any physical sense, but the same as the poses makes it look way more artistic when looked from the camera.
